Ingredients
Scale
- 3–4 lbs chuck roast
- 1 cup whole berry cranberry sauce
- 2 medium onions, sliced
- 1 cup low-sodium beef broth
- 4 garlic cloves, minced
- 2 tsp fresh thyme leaves
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tbsp low-sodium soy sauce
Instructions
- Season the chuck roast generously with salt and pepper. Optionally, sear in a skillet over medium-high heat for 3-4 minutes per side.
- Place sliced onions at the bottom of the slow cooker. Add the seared roast on top, followed by cranberry sauce, garlic, and thyme.
- Pour beef broth and soy sauce around the roast.
- Cover and cook on low for 8 hours or high for 4 hours until the meat is tender.
- Serve with mashed potatoes or crusty bread, drizzled with remaining sauce.
